The Global Hepatitis B Treatment Market is projected to expand from USD 5.11 Billion in 2025 to USD 6.52 Billion by 2031, registering a CAGR of 4.14%. This market encompasses the distribution of immune modulators and antiviral medications designed to suppress viral replication and mitigate liver injury. Key factors driving this industry include the growing worldwide incidence of chronic infections alongside enhanced governmental efforts regarding screening and vaccination, highlighting the urgent requirement for potent therapeutic solutions. As reported by the World Health Organization, an estimated 254 million individuals globally were living with chronic hepatitis B infection in 2024.

Conversely, a significant obstacle retarding market expansion is the high frequency of underdiagnosis, especially within developing nations. The expensive nature of lifelong therapy combined with insufficient healthcare infrastructure prevents a large segment of the infected population from receiving essential care. This gap between the high prevalence of the disease and the low volume of diagnosed patients constrains the commercially viable market, establishing a substantial hurdle for pharmaceutical firms seeking to broaden their global presence.
Market Driver
Increased research and development funding for functional cure therapies is fundamentally transforming the Global Hepatitis B Treatment Market, moving from lifelong viral suppression models to finite treatment courses that reinstate immune regulation. Pharmaceutical innovators are actively exploring new modalities, such as small interfering RNAs and capsid assembly modulators, which attack distinct phases of the viral lifecycle to realize sustained seroclearance. These efforts are producing encouraging clinical results; for instance, Vir Biotechnology reported in May 2025 that preliminary phase 2 study data showed its investigational combination therapy attained a 15% functional cure rate in a specific patient subgroup, signaling a strategic shift toward curative treatments that overcome the limitations of existing nucleoside analogues.
At the same time, the broadening of government-led screening and immunization initiatives is improving patient detection and access to care, especially in areas with high infection rates. National health strategies are increasingly adopting viral elimination targets, backed by international partnerships that enhance access to preventative resources. According to the Hepatitis B Foundation's 2024 Annual Report, the Gavi alliance initiated a campaign in June 2024 to roll out the hepatitis B birth dose vaccine in 32 African nations. These public health efforts are enlarging the diagnosed patient base, thereby bolstering the commercial prospects for antiviral producers, a trend reflected by Gilead Sciences in February 2025, when the company announced an 8% rise in full-year 2024 product sales (excluding Veklury) driven largely by its liver disease portfolio.
Market Challenge
The major limitation hindering the full economic development of the hepatitis B treatment market is the substantial rate of underdiagnosis. While the global prevalence indicates a vast pool of potential antiviral users, the commercially accessible market is much smaller because the majority of individuals are unaware of their infection status. This widespread lack of awareness causes a significant disconnect between the number of existing cases and those actively seeking medical treatment, effectively curtailing revenue opportunities for manufacturers of therapeutic agents.
This gap in diagnosis directly limits prescription volumes and hampers the adoption of existing medications. Despite having sufficient inventory, pharmaceutical companies encounter a growth ceiling as long as most infected individuals remain outside the healthcare network. According to the World Health Organization, only 13 percent of people living with chronic hepatitis B had been diagnosed by 2024. This figure underscores that the industry currently serves only a fraction of the total patient population, creating a market dynamic where potential demand significantly outstrips actual sales.
Market Trends
The clinical testing of therapeutic vaccines is becoming a key strategic priority aimed at achieving sustained viral control by revitalizing the host's depleted T-cell response. In contrast to standard antivirals that mainly suppress replication, these experimental vaccines seek to stimulate specific immunity, potentially allowing patients to end lifelong treatment. This strategy is demonstrating real progress; according to a November 2024 press release regarding ongoing Phase 2b trial results, Barinthus Biotherapeutics reported that eight subjects treated with candidate VTP-300 achieved HBsAg loss at some point, with two qualifying as functional cures, highlighting the promise of vaccination in overcoming immune tolerance.
Concurrently, there is a notable market emphasis on immunomodulatory candidates, specifically monoclonal antibodies engineered to swiftly lower viral antigen loads. Developers are focusing on agents capable of depleting circulating hepatitis B surface antigen (HBsAg), thereby eliminating a key immune suppression mechanism to aid recovery. This trend is illustrated by recent clinical achievements; Bluejay Therapeutics announced in November 2024 that 100% of participants receiving a 300 mg weekly dose of their monoclonal antibody BJT-778 achieved a virologic response by Week 44. Such progress signifies a wider industry movement toward immunotherapies that work alongside direct-acting antivirals to improve functional cure rates.
